码迷,mamicode.com
首页 > Web开发 > 详细

js的基础要点

时间:2017-08-03 23:08:15      阅读:208      评论:0      收藏:0      [点我收藏+]

标签:function   参数   脚本   设置   变量   java   打开   返回值   prompt   

 javascript作为一种脚本语言可以放在html页面中任何位置,但是浏览器解释html时是按先后顺序的,所以前面的script就先被执行。比如进行页面显示初始化的js必须放在head里面,因为初始化都要求提前进行(如给页面body设置css等);而如果是通过事件调用执行的function那么对位置没什么要求的。

1. 在JS中区分大小写,如变量mychar与myChar是不一样的,表示是两个变量。

2. 变量虽然也可以不声明,直接使用,但不规范,需要先声明,后使用。

函数是完成某个特定功能的一组语句。如没有函数,完成任务可能需要五行、十行、甚至更多的代码。这时我们就可以把完成特定功能的代码块放到一个函数里,直接调用这个函数,就省重复输入大量代码的麻烦。

第一种:输出内容用""括起,直接输出""号内的内容。

document.write()

第二种:通过变量,输出内容

<script type="text/javascript">
  var myJs="hello world!";
  document.write(myJs); 
</script>

第三种:输出多项内容,内容之间用+号连接。
<script type="text/javascript">
  var myJs="hello";
  document.write(myJs+"I love JavaScript"); 
</script>
第四种:输出HTML标签,并起作用,标签使用""括起来。
<script type="text/javascript">
  var myJs="hello";
document.write(myJs+"<br>");
  document.write("JavaScript");
</script>
alert(字符串或变量);  
confirm(str);str:在消息对话框中要显示的文本  返回值: Boolean值
prompt(str1, str2);str1: 要显示在消息对话框中的文本,不可修改   str2:文本框中的内容,可以修改
window.open([URL], [窗口名称], [参数字符串])
URL:可选参数,在窗口中要显示网页的网址或路径。如果省略这个参数,或者它的值是空字符串,那么窗口就不显示任何文档。
窗口名称:可选参数,被打开窗口的名称。
1.该名称由字母、数字和下划线字符组成。
2."_top"、"_blank"、"_self"具有特殊意义的名称。
    _blank:在新窗口显示目标网页
    _self:在当前窗口显示目标网页
    _top:框架网页中在上部窗口中显示目标网页
3.相同 name 的窗口只能创建一个,要想创建多个窗口则 name 不能相同。
4.name 不能包含有空格。 参数字符串:可选参数,设置窗口参数,各参数用逗号隔开。
window.close();   //关闭本窗口
<窗口对象>.close();   //关闭指定的窗口

HTML文档可以说由节点构成的集合,三种常见的DOM节点:

1. 元素节点:<html>、<body>、<p>等都是元素节点,即标签。

2. 文本节点:向用户展示的内容,如<li>...</li>中的JavaScript、DOM、CSS等文本。

3. 属性节点:元素属性,如<a>标签的链接属性href="http://www.baidu.com"。

document.getElementById(“id”) 获取到的是整个对象

Object.style.property=new style;
Object.style.display = value(none隐藏/block显示 需引号)
object.className = classname   1.获取元素的class   属性2.为网页内的某个元素指定一个css样式来更改该元素的外观(类名需用引号)
 
 

js的基础要点

标签:function   参数   脚本   设置   变量   java   打开   返回值   prompt   

原文地址:http://www.cnblogs.com/lhl66/p/7282536.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!